Buy a ready modified 1100D and you are ready to go. It should cost £250-300. Just modifying and getting the D5100 ready for long exposures will cost more than that.

There are several drawbacks with Nikon, no USB BULB (means max 30 sec) with cheaper/older cameras without extra adapters/cables,  smaller bayonett that can create vignetting on some telescopes, stareater feature on older camera that makes small stars dissapear because of internal noise reduction even on RAW files.
